A program that generally prepares individuals to undertake and manage the process of developing consumer audiences and moving products from producers to consumers. Includes instruction in buyer behavior and dynamics, principle of marketing research, demand analysis, cost-volume and profit relationships, pricing theory, marketing campaign and strategic planning, market segments, advertising methods, sales operations and management, consumer relations, retailing, and applications to specific products and markets.

The average starting salary for a graduate with a bachelor's degree in Marketing/Marketing Management, General is $40,600.
Some of the highest paying careers for Marketing/Marketing Management, General majors include Marketing Managers, Sales Managers and Advertising and Promotions Managers. But, another thing to consider is how much demand there is for certain positions. Jobs that are in high need that a degree in Marketing/Marketing Management, General can prepare you for are Market Research Analysts and Marketing Specialists, Sales Managers and Marketing Managers.
These are the highest paying careers for Marketing/Marketing Management, General majors.
Career | Median Salary | Average Annual Job Openings | Employment 2022 | Employment 2032 | % Change |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Marketing Managers | $157,620 | 31,200 | 358,200 | 381,900 | 7% | |
Sales Managers | $135,160 | 43,200 | 554,700 | 577,200 | 4% | |
Advertising and Promotions Managers | $131,870 | 2,800 | 30,900 | 31,400 | 2% | |
Fundraising Managers | $119,200 | 2,500 | 33,700 | 35,400 | 5% | |
Business Teachers, Postsecondary | $97,130 | 8,700 | 99,900 | 106,900 | 7% | |
Market Research Analysts and Marketing Specialists Search Marketing Strategists | $74,680 | 94,600 | 868,600 | 985,200 | 13% | |
Fundraisers | $64,160 | 9,900 | 124,000 | 130,500 | 5% |
